How it Works (Beginner Friendly)

For those new to the world of podcasts, a brief introduction is in order. A podcast is an episodic audio series where hosts discuss various topics, interview guests, or share personal stories. They are usually available for streaming or download on platforms like Apple Podcasts, Spotify, or Google Podcasts. Pat McAfee's podcast, in particular, operates in a similar manner, featuring in-depth conversations and sharing of personal opinions.
